Core Viewpoint - The Chinese Ministry of Defense has expressed strong dissatisfaction regarding Japan's recent military activities, particularly concerning the close encounters between Chinese aircraft carriers and Japanese Self-Defense Force aircraft in the Pacific Ocean [1] Group 1: Military Activities - The Chinese Navy's aircraft carriers, Liaoning and Shandong, conducted routine training exercises in the Western Pacific, marking the first time both carriers operated simultaneously in this region [1] - Japanese naval and air forces have reportedly been frequently approaching and interfering with Chinese military exercises, which China views as a deliberate attempt to create security risks in the air and sea [1] Group 2: Diplomatic Response - The Chinese Ministry of Defense has lodged a formal protest with Japan, demanding an end to what it describes as dangerous provocations that could lead to unforeseen incidents in the air and sea [1] - China asserts that its carrier group activities are conducted in international waters and do not target any specific country, aligning with international law and practices [1] Group 3: Legal and Professional Conduct - The Chinese military emphasizes that its responses to Japanese incursions into its training areas are reasonable, legal, and conducted with professionalism and restraint [1]
